Continuous process improvement is a systematic approach to making small, incremental changes in processes in order to improve efficiency, quality, and overall performance.
Key Features
- Identifying areas for improvement
- Implementing changes
- Measuring effectiveness of changes
- Continuous monitoring and adjustment
Pros
- Leads to increased efficiency and productivity
- Encourages innovation and creativity
- Promotes a culture of learning and growth
Cons
- Can be time-consuming and require dedicated resources
- Resistance to change from employees
